Indian women have become a formidable force in America, bridging continents and cultures to achieve remarkable success. These American Daughters of India have excelled across various fields, from technology and business to academia and philanthropy. Jayshree Ullal, for instance, rose to become the President and CEO of Arista Networks, with a net worth of $2.2 billion in 2023[10]. Neerja Sethi co-founded Syntel, an IT consulting firm that grew from a $30,000 first-year revenue to a $700 million enterprise[2]. These women, along with others like Indra Nooyi and Anjali Sud, have broken barriers and become inspirations for future generations. Their achievements highlight the strength, resilience, and entrepreneurial spirit of Indian women who have embraced the American dream while maintaining their cultural roots
